在日常办公或数据处理工作中,我们经常会遇到表格中含有汉字数字和阿拉伯数字混合的情况。这种情况可能会导致数据提取和统计分析的困难。为了提高工作效率,快速而准确地提取这些数字信息显得尤为重要。本文将为您详细介绍几种提高提取效率的方法。
1. 使用Excel的文本处理功能
Excel是一款强大的电子表格软件,它提供了多种文本处理功能,可以帮助用户快速提取表格中的汉字数字。
1.1 利用“查找和替换”功能
首先,我们可以使用Excel的“查找和替换”功能。通过此功能,用户能够查找特定的汉字数字并将其替换为阿拉伯数字。这在批量处理数据时特别有效。
例如,如果表格中包含“壹”、“贰”等汉字数字,可以在“查找”和“替换”窗口中输入相应的内容,并将其替换为“1”、“2”等阿拉伯数字。使用快捷键Ctrl+H可以快速打开这个功能。
1.2 使用文本函数进行提取
除了查找和替换,Excel还提供了一些文本函数,比如“MID”、“FIND”、“LEN”等,可以帮助用户提取特定格式的文本。用户可以通过编写简单的公式来提取包含汉字数字的文本段落。
例如,MID函数可以轻松提取字符串的特定部分,根据汉字数字的位置进行提取,也是一个非常有效的方式。
2. 运用Python进行批量处理
对于熟悉编程的用户,Python提供了更加灵活和强大的方法来提取汉字数字。
2.1 使用正则表达式
Python的re模块使得处理字符串变得简单。通过编写正则表达式,我们可以匹配表格中包含的汉字数字,并将其提取出来。
例如,可以使用以下简单的代码段来提取汉字数字:
import retext = "今天的销售额为壹佰元,去年为玖拾贰元。"
result = re.findall(r"[零一二三四五六七八九十百千万亿]+", text)
print(result) # 输出: ['壹佰', '玖拾贰']
2.2 自定义函数进行转化
在Python中,我们还可以自定义一个函数,将汉字数字转换为阿拉伯数字。通过遍历文本中的每个汉字,判断其对应的数值,进行累加或乘法运算,最终完成转换。
这样的功能不仅可以处理数字,还能通过良好的代码结构提升数据处理的效率。
3. 借助专业工具进行提取
除了Excel和Python,还有一些专业的数据处理工具可以帮助用户快速提取表格中的汉字数字。这些工具通常具有更高的精确度和效率。
3.1 OCR技术
OCR(光学字符识别)技术可以将图像中的文字转化为可编辑的文本。对于一些格式复杂的表格,OCR可以通过图像扫描直接提取其中的汉字数字,方便后续处理。
用户只需将含有汉字数字的表格图像上传至OCR工具,系统将自动识别并输出文本。该过程非常高效,且可以节省大量人力资源。
3.2 数据分析软件
其他一些专门的数据分析软件,如Tableau、SPSS等,通常也提供了相应的数据处理模块,可以进行数据清洗和提取操作。这些软件具有强大的可视化功能,用户能够更加直观地看到数据变换的过程。
在这些软件中,用户可以通过拖拽和配置的方式,轻松设定数据信息的提取条件,获取所需的汉字数字数据。
4. 注意事项
在提取汉字数字的过程中,用户应该特别注意数据的准确性和完整性。特别是在使用自动化工具和脚本时,可能会发生一些识别错误。
4.1 检查结果的准确性
无论是通过Excel、Python还是其他工具提取数据,第一时间都应该检查提取结果的准确性。必要时,可以进行人工复核,以避免因系统错误带来的数据偏差。
4.2 保存原始数据
在进行数据处理时,建议用户始终保存一份原始数据的备份。这不仅可以防止数据丢失,还能为后续的扩展分析提供基础。
总之,快速提取表格中汉字数字的方式有很多,选择合适的方法可以大幅提高工作效率。希望本文的分享对您有所帮助,并促进数据处理工作的顺利进行。